X's updated privacy policy allows sharing user info with third-party collaborators for training AI models, raising concerns about user data control and transparency.
The new section on 'third-party collaborators' indicates that unless users opt out, their data may be used by external companies for independent purposes, including AI training.
Although users have the option to opt out of data sharing, clarity on how to do this remains absent in the current policy structure.
X is also tightening its terms against data scraping, instituting strict penalties for accessing large volumes of tweets, highlighting their commitment to data protection.
